Tuesday, November 19, 130pm-330 (Room 416 – AC Conv. Ctr.)
Valuation of Assisted Living Facilities for Tax Assessment 2 App. CEU
Communities throughout New Jersey are experiencing a rise in elderly residents. The need for assisted care facilities will continue to grow. To meet the need continuing care assisted living facilities are appearing across the state. This session is designed to inform participants about value methodologies used to appraise assisted living facilities. An additional component is their treatment in NJ Tax Court.

Wednesday, November 20, 2-4pm (Brighton Ballroom –Hard Rock)
Big Box Appeals….Issues & Solutions 2 Appr. CEU
Big box retail continues to occupy a vital share of the commercial real estate market. But the rise of on line shopping and the “dark store” raises some interesting questions related to real estate use and valuation of the facilities. Peter Korpacz defines some of the issues…”Do they have the same highest and best use? Are they worth the same? Should appraisers use the same comps for both valuations?” Attendees will also receive the solutions.

Thursday, November 21, 130pm – 330 (Room 412 – AC Conv. Ctr.)
Hotel Valuation 2 Appr. CEU
Income, FF&E, Rushmore, and other relevant points will be covered in this session. Hotels, motels, extended stays, all sell and volumes of data exist within that market. How does one gather, analyze, utilize? What weight does the value professional give to the cost approach, the sales comparison approach and the income approach?
